⚖️ Decision summary

This Landlord application — Eviction for non-payment of rent — was resolved by a consent order between the parties.

📑 Findings & determinations

It is ordered on consent that: 1. The Tenants shall pay to the Landlord $8,186.00 which represents arrears of rent ($8,000.00) plus the application filing fee ($186.00) for the period ending January 31, 2026. 2. The Tenants shall pay to the Landlord the amount set out in paragraph 1 in accordance with the following schedule: Date Payment Due Amount of Payment On or before February 1, 2026 $3,000.00 On or before March 1, 2026 $500.00 On or before April 1, 2026 $500.00 File Number: LTB-L-091029- 25 Order Page 2 of 2 On or before May 1, 2026 $500.00 On or before June 1, 2026 $500.00 On or before July 1, 2026 $500.00 On or before August 1, 2026 $500.00 On or before September 1, 2026 $500.00 On or before October 1, 2026 $500.00 On or before November 1, 2026 $500.00 On or before December 1, 2026 $500.00 On or before January 1, 2027 $186.00 3. The Tenants shall also pay to the Landlord new rent on time and in full as it comes due and owing for the period February 1, 2026 to January 1, 2027, or until the arrears are paid in full, whichever date is earliest. 4.
